Output 516c805620dae3c05b837e4de7cf60db2bb3eb4df48cf1eaddf3934b5e111d9d:0

value
21520000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f9878328c7a1cc949338db84345790c5e8f7f693 OP_EQUAL
address
MWeYpkwnRewweEWwqesa7KQPofky7nhwR8
transaction
516c805620dae3c05b837e4de7cf60db2bb3eb4df48cf1eaddf3934b5e111d9d
spent
true